[發明專利]一種熱詞匯集推送方法、裝置及網絡服務器有效
| 申請號: | 201810974923.5 | 申請日: | 2018-08-24 |
| 公開(公告)號: | CN109376295B | 公開(公告)日: | 2021-08-13 |
| 發明(設計)人: | 賀向波 | 申請(專利權)人: | 北京達佳互聯信息技術有限公司 |
| 主分類號: | G06F16/9535 | 分類號: | G06F16/9535;H04L29/08 |
| 代理公司: | 北京潤澤恒知識產權代理有限公司 11319 | 代理人: | 莎日娜 |
| 地址: | 100084 北京市海淀區*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 詞匯 推送 方法 裝置 網絡 服務器 | ||
本申請提供了一種熱詞匯集推送方法、裝置和網絡服務器,該方法和裝置應用于網絡服務器,具體為匯集一個時間片內被輸入的每個關鍵詞的輸入量;根據所有輸入量計算時間片內的top?N搜索詞及每個搜索詞的搜索量,并將top?N搜索詞和搜索量存入數據庫;每隔一個預設時長,根據搜索量對top?N搜索詞進行更新;當用戶向搜索終端的搜索界面輸入關鍵詞時,向搜索終端推送top?N搜索詞,以使搜索界面上顯示top?N搜索詞供用戶選定。通過在搜索界面上顯示多個搜索詞供用戶選擇,方便了用戶的輸入,從而提供了用戶的使用體驗。
技術領域
本申請涉及互聯網技術,尤其涉及一種熱詞匯集推送方法、裝置和網絡服務器。
背景技術
網絡搜索作為互聯網的基礎功能之一,對于任何提供互聯網服務的公司來說都是必不可少的。當用戶通過搜索界面進行搜索時,如果能夠確定出一些熱度較高的問題的關鍵詞,并將這些關鍵詞在搜索界面上顯示出來供用戶選擇,可以使用戶使用搜索功能時更為方便,從而能夠有效提高用戶的搜索體驗,并提高用戶的忠誠度。
發明內容
為實現上述所提到的目的,本申請提供一種熱詞匯集推送方法、裝置和網絡服務器。
根據本公開實施例的第一方面,提供一種熱詞匯集推送方法,應用于網絡服務器,所述熱詞匯集推送方法包括步驟:
匯集一個時間片內被輸入的每個關鍵詞的輸入量;
根據所有所述輸入量計算所述時間片內的top-N搜索詞及每個所述搜索詞的搜索量,并將所述top-N搜索詞和所述搜索量存入數據庫;
每隔一個預設時長,根據所述搜索量對所述top-N搜索詞進行更新;
當用戶向搜索終端的搜索界面輸入關鍵詞時,向所述搜索終端推送所述top-N搜索詞,以使所述搜索界面上顯示top-N搜索詞供用戶選定。
可選的,所述數據庫為redis。
可選的,還包括步驟:
將所有所述關鍵詞中未被審核通過的詞匯發送給審核人員;
在所述審核人員通過審核界面對所述詞匯進行審核后,將審核結果以消息形式發出;
通過監聽消息將所述審核結果對所述數據庫中的所述top-N搜索詞進行更新。
可選的,所述將所有所述關鍵詞中未被審核通過的詞匯發送給審核人員,包括:
將所述詞匯通過kafka方式發送給所述審核人員。
可選的,所述將審核結果以消息形式發出,包括
將所述審核結果通過kafka方式以消息形式發出。
根據本公開實施例的第二方面,提供一種熱詞匯集推送裝置,應用于網絡服務器,所述熱詞匯集推送裝置包括:
關鍵詞匯集模塊,被配置為用于匯集一個時間片內被輸入的每個關鍵詞的輸入量;
搜索詞處理模塊,被配置為用于根據所有所述輸入量計算所述時間片內的top-N搜索詞及每個所述搜索詞的搜索量,并將所述top-N搜索詞和所述搜索量存入數據庫;
詞庫更新模塊,被配置為用于每隔一個預設時長,根據所述搜索量對所述top-N搜索詞進行更新;
熱詞推送模塊,被配置為用于當用戶向搜索終端的搜索界面輸入關鍵詞時,向所述搜索終端推送所述top-N搜索詞,以使所述搜索界面上顯示top-N搜索詞供用戶選定。
可選的,所述數據庫為redis。
可選的,還包括:
詞匯發送模塊,被配置為用于將所有所述關鍵詞中未被審核通過的詞匯發送給審核人員;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于北京達佳互聯信息技術有限公司,未經北京達佳互聯信息技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810974923.5/2.html,轉載請聲明來源鉆瓜專利網。





